Auguste Comte (1798-1857): A Pioneering Mind in 19th Century European Thought This evocative pencil engraving captures the intellectual intensity and innovative spirit of Auguste Comte, a French philosopher and sociologist who left an indelible mark on European thought in the 19th century. Born in Montpellier in 1798, Comte is considered the founder of sociology as an academic discipline. He is best known for his theory of positivism, which advocated for the application of the scientific method to the study of society and human behavior. Comte's groundbreaking work challenged the dominant philosophical paradigms of his time, which focused primarily on individualism and abstract reasoning. Instead, he emphasized the importance of understanding the social structures and institutions that shape human experience. His influential ideas on social evolution and the role of women in society were particularly visionary, anticipating many of the debates that would shape the modern world.
